Brass bushings, an essential component in numerous mechanical applications, are renowned for their toughness, adaptability, and efficiency. These bushings can be found in a number of types, each tailored to fulfill certain needs in design and machinery. Straight brass bushings, one of one of the most common kinds, are cylindrical fit and utilized extensively in applications where axial tons are predominant. Their capacity to stand up to significant damage makes them optimal for heavy-duty procedures. On the other hand, flanged brass bushings include an extended edge, or flange, at one end. This flange offers added support to the bearing surface area and assists to much better handle axial loads, making these bushings appropriate for applications needing both radial and axial load handling.

Bimetal composite bushings are a sophisticated evolution in bushing innovation, incorporating the best properties of 2 metals. Normally, these bushings have a steel backing and a brass or bronze lining. This combination supplies a strong, long lasting support structure with superb bearing residential properties, ensuring both strength and low rubbing. These bushings are widely utilized in auto and industrial applications where high tons capacity and sturdiness are required. Brass drive washing machines are flat, washer-like components that bear axial tons. They are generally made use of in auto transmissions and equipment assemblies to stop motion along the axis of the shaft, reducing rubbing and put on between moving parts.

Brass slide blocks are one more alternative made use of in equipment calling for smooth sliding motion. These blocks, frequently integrated into directing systems, offer trustworthy and regular efficiency, making sure marginal rubbing and wear. Brass round ordinary bearings, defined by their round internal surface, enable angular motion and imbalance between connected parts. These bearings are vital in applications where there is a demand for turning and oscillation under differing lots, such as in hydraulic cylinders and hefty equipment joints.

Among the considerable improvements in this field is the development of self-lubricating graphite oilless bushings. These bushings include graphite plugs within the brass matrix, supplying constant lubrication without the need for additional oiling. This attribute substantially decreases maintenance needs and enhances the bushing's life expectancy.

Copper alloy bushings, similar to brass bushings, supply outstanding corrosion resistance and thermal conductivity. These properties make them excellent for use in atmospheres where exposure to severe chemicals or high temperatures prevails. Solid lubricating bushings, an additional development, integrate solid lubricating substances like graphite or PTFE into the bushing product. These bushings offer regular lubrication and low rubbing, even in settings where standard lubes could fall short, such as in high-temperature or vacuum cleaner applications.

Direct brass bushings, made for linear movement applications, are another important type of bushing. These bushings facilitate smooth and low-friction motion along a straight path, which is vital in equipment like CNC machines, printers, and other accuracy equipment. They provide high accuracy and excellent performance, making sure marginal wear over time. Mold overview bushings, made use of primarily in shot molding equipments, guide the mold cuts in half right into alignment during the mold and mildew's closing stage. These bushings are vital for preserving the specific placement necessary for creating top quality shaped items continually.
